Why AI matters at this scale

Haworth is a global leader in the design and manufacture of commercial furniture, particularly office furnishings and adaptable workspace solutions. Founded in 1948 and employing 5,001-10,000 people, the company operates at a scale where efficiency, customization, and supply chain resilience are critical competitive advantages. As a large enterprise in the manufacturing sector, Haworth faces pressures from global competition, fluctuating material costs, and evolving workplace trends. AI presents a transformative lever to optimize complex operations, personalize B2B customer experiences, and innovate product development in a traditionally physical industry.

Concrete AI Opportunities with ROI Framing

1. Generative Design for Sustainable Products: Implementing AI-driven generative design software can dramatically shorten the R&D cycle for new furniture lines. By inputting parameters like material properties, cost targets, ergonomic standards, and sustainability goals, AI can produce thousands of viable design options. This accelerates innovation, reduces prototyping costs, and helps create products optimized for material efficiency and disassembly, directly supporting corporate sustainability objectives and reducing waste-related expenses.

2. Predictive Supply Chain and Manufacturing: Haworth's global manufacturing footprint involves complex logistics and inventory management. Machine learning models can analyze historical data, market signals, and real-time logistics information to forecast demand, predict machine maintenance needs, and optimize inventory levels. The ROI comes from reduced downtime, lower inventory carrying costs, and improved on-time delivery rates to large corporate clients, strengthening customer loyalty and operational margins.

3. AI-Enhanced Sales and Configuration Tools: For a company selling complex, configurable products directly to businesses, an AI-powered digital configurator can be a powerful sales tool. Integrating computer vision, it could allow clients to upload office floor plans and receive AI-generated furniture layouts and product recommendations. This improves the sales process, increases deal size through better space utilization suggestions, and collects valuable data on customer preferences to inform future designs.

Deployment Risks Specific to This Size Band

For a company of Haworth's size (5,001-10,000 employees), AI deployment carries specific risks. Integrating AI with entrenched legacy Enterprise Resource Planning (ERP) and manufacturing execution systems can be costly and complex, potentially causing operational disruption. The scale also means that change management is a significant hurdle; upskilling thousands of employees across design, factory floor, and sales roles requires substantial investment in training and clear communication of benefits. Furthermore, large-scale data initiatives must navigate data silos across different global divisions and ensure compliance with varying international data regulations, adding layers of governance complexity not faced by smaller firms.

How can AI help a traditional furniture manufacturer like Haworth?
AI transforms core operations: generative design accelerates R&D, predictive analytics optimize global supply chains, and computer vision improves manufacturing quality, driving efficiency and innovation in a competitive market.
What are the biggest barriers to AI adoption for a company this size?
Key barriers include integrating AI with legacy manufacturing systems, high initial investment for custom solutions, and upskilling a large, established workforce to work with new data-driven processes.
Can AI support Haworth's sustainability initiatives?
Yes. AI can optimize material usage to reduce waste, enable design for disassembly and recycling, and model the carbon footprint of products across their lifecycle, supporting circular economy goals.
Is there an AI use case for sales and customer experience?
AI can power smart product configurators, generate personalized proposals for corporate clients, and analyze customer feedback to inform future product lines and features.
